Extraction Of Copper | Mining, Concentration, Smelting

Copper Mining: The commonest ore used in the extraction of copper is Chalcopyrite (CuFeS 2) also known as Copper Pyrites and other such sulphides. The percentage of copper in the actual ore is too low for direct extraction of copper to be viable. The concentration of ore is required and it is done by the Froth Flotation method. Copper processing | Definition, History, & Facts | Britannica

The search for copper during this early period led to the discovery and working of deposits of native copper. Sometime after 6000 bce the discovery was made that the metal could be melted in the campfire and cast into the desired shape. Then followed the discovery of the relation of metallic copper to copper-bearing rock and the possibility of reducing ores to the metal by the …

12.3 Primary Copper Smelting

(1.6 millon tons) of ore produced in 1991. Copper is produced in the U. S. primarily by pyrometallurgical smelting methods. Pyrometallurgical techniques use heat to separate copper from copper sulfide ore concentrates. Process steps include mining, concentration, roasting, smelting, converting, and finally fire and electrolytic refining.

The Mining Process

The mining process at Macraes is circular and follows a cycle of exploration, mining, processing and rehabilitation and closure. With a 30-year history of development spanning fluctuating gold prices, there are multiple examples of where an area has been explored, mined, processed and rehabilitated, only to be explored mined, processed and rehabilitated again 10 to 20 years later.

Unveiling the Secrets of Copper Mining Process

Underground Mining, on the other hand, is employed when copper deposits are located deep below the Earth's surface.This method involves creating a network of tunnels and shafts to reach and extract the ore. While underground mining is more expensive and complex than open-pit mining, it is more suitable for high-grade ores found at greater depths.
